About Loring Park Dog Park

Nestled in the heart of Minneapolis, Loring Park Dog Park provides a compact but enjoyable space for pups and their owners. The park features gravel surfaces that help keep paws clean, along with pools and water dishes available for those hot summer days. While the space isn’t very large, it’s filled with plenty of toys and play areas, including intriguing rocks and even a bridge, making it a delightful playground for dogs to explore.

Many locals appreciate the community atmosphere, with dog owners often being responsible and attentive while their dogs play. However, some users have raised concerns about an increasing number of dogs without proper licenses and vaccinations. This has led to some unease among regulars, who feel that monitoring could improve the experience, particularly as the park police can’t always oversee the area. Bringing your own water is a smart choice, as access to the water features requires a key.

Evenings at Loring Park can be quite picturesque, with beautiful sunsets casting lovely light across the flowers. Frequently Asked Questions

Is Loring Park Dog Park fenced and safe for off-leash play?
Yes, Loring Park Dog Park is fenced, making it a secure off-leash space. That said, reviewers recommend staying attentive—while most owners are responsible, monitoring by park staff can be inconsistent.
What water access does Loring Park have in Minneapolis?
The park features water pools and dishes, which are especially nice for dogs on hot summer days. Keep in mind that accessing some water features requires a key, so bringing your own water bottle is a smart backup plan.
What's the surface and layout like at this dog park?
Loring Park has gravel surfaces to help keep paws relatively clean, with toys, play areas, rocks, and even a bridge for dogs to explore. It's compact rather than sprawling, but packed with things to do.
